Abstract
This study aims to determine if an inflation-targeting (IT) framework is effective in the case of the Philippines, comparing the adoption to previous approaches in monetary policy. The results show that the adoption of an IT framework has helped the Philippines keep output and exchange rates monitored. However, there is insufficient evidence that it is effectively targeting inflation.
